Consumer Protection Council urges price cuts

The consumer right protection council has urged Traders Association of Nigeria to help in bringing down the high prices of goods in the country.

Director General of the Council ,Mrs Lfy Umuenyi made the appeal when she met with some Executive committee members of the Traders Association of Nigeria in Abuja.


She decried the high rate of prices of goods and transportation fares in the country and called on marketers to

reduce the prices in the interest of the country

Mrs Umuenyi said from a survey carried out it was discovered  that there was a 39 percent increase in the prices of goods in the markets.

The director General  also condemned the increased rate of adulterated  goods in the markets,pointing out the consumers had been deprived the worth of their money
